Overview of the Canon Selphy CP1500

The Canon Selphy CP1500 is renowned for its portability and ease of use. It offers high-quality photo printing in a compact design, making it ideal for both home and on-the-go use. It supports various connectivity options, including Wi-Fi, USB, and SD cards, allowing versatile printing options.

Key features include a 3.2-inch LCD screen for easy navigation, dye-sublimation printing technology for vibrant images, and the ability to print 4x6 inch photos in approximately 47 seconds. Its compact size makes it perfect for small spaces or mobile setups.

Overview of the Dnp DS620A

The Dnp DS620A is a professional-grade photo printer designed for high-volume printing. It is favored by photographers and print shops for its durability and high-quality output. The DS620A uses dye-sublimation technology and offers a range of print sizes, including 4x6, 5x7, and 8x10 inches.

Its key features include a 2.8-inch color LCD, fast print speeds, and robust build quality. The printer supports Ethernet, USB, and Wi-Fi connections, making it suitable for various professional environments. The Dnp DS620A is known for its consistent color accuracy and longevity of prints.

Performance Comparison

The Canon Selphy CP1500 produces vibrant, sharp images with accurate color reproduction, thanks to its dye-sublimation process. It excels in producing high-quality photos suitable for casual use and small events.

The Dnp DS620A offers professional-grade print quality with exceptional color accuracy and detail. Its larger print sizes and higher resolution make it suitable for professional photographers and commercial use.

Speed and Efficiency

The Canon CP1500 can print a 4x6 photo in approximately 47 seconds, making it suitable for quick, on-demand printing. Its compact design allows for rapid setup and minimal maintenance.

The Dnp DS620A boasts faster print speeds, especially for larger formats, and is built for high-volume production. It can handle multiple prints efficiently, making it ideal for professional environments.

Connectivity and Usability

The Canon Selphy CP1500 offers user-friendly features such as a touchscreen interface, Wi-Fi, USB, and SD card support. Its portability and simple operation make it accessible for casual users and small businesses.

The Dnp DS620A provides multiple connectivity options, including Ethernet, Wi-Fi, and USB, suitable for integrated workflows. Its interface is more suited for professional use, with advanced settings and higher customization options.

Price and Value

As of 2026, the Canon Selphy CP1500 is generally more affordable, targeting consumers and casual users. Its price point reflects its portability and ease of use.

The Dnp DS620A, being a professional-grade printer, commands a higher price but offers greater durability, higher volume capacity, and superior print quality. It provides value for commercial and professional users who require consistent, high-quality output.
